Description

1-Oxaspiro[3.5]Nona-5,8-Diene-3-Carbonitrile,2-Ethoxy-7-Oxo-,trans-(9Ci) is a specialized spirocyclic organic compound featuring a unique oxaspiro framework integrated with a diene and nitrile functionality. This complex molecular architecture makes it a valuable and versatile advanced pharmaceutical intermediate for synthesizing novel active ingredients. It is primarily utilized by research organizations and fine chemical manufacturers engaged in the development of new therapeutic agents and complex organic molecules.

Basic Information

Product Name 1-Oxaspiro[3.5]Nona-5,8-Diene-3-Carbonitrile,2-Ethoxy-7-Oxo-,trans-(9Ci)
CAS No. 137378-90-6
Molecular Formula C12H13NO3
Molecular Weight 219.24 g/mol
Synonyms trans-2-Ethoxy-7-oxo-1-oxaspiro[3.5]nona-5,8-diene-3-carbonitrile; 1-Oxaspiro[3.5]non-5,8-diene-3-carbonitrile, 2-ethoxy-7-oxo-, trans-; 2-Ethoxy-7-oxo-1-oxaspiro[3.5]nona-5,8-diene-3-carbonitrile; Spiro[3.5]nona-5,8-diene-3-carbonitrile, 2-ethoxy-7-oxo-1-oxa-, trans-; (trans)-2-Ethoxy-7-oxo-1-oxaspiro[3.5]nona-5,8-diene-3-carbonitrile

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(typically 15-25°C). Keep away from strong bases and incompatible materials such as strong oxidizing agents. The container should be kept tightly sealed in a dry environment to maintain stability.
